What Mathway offers in the classroom

Mathway provides step-by-step solutions, diagrams, and multiple problem-solving pathways. For teachers, these features can save time on routine checks, enable personalized remediation, and support flipped-classroom models. For students, quick access to solutions can foster curiosity when used as a scaffold rather than a substitute for effort.

  • Procedural support: stepwise explanations that reinforce methodic approaches.
  • Adaptive practice: varying problem sets that challenge students at different levels.
  • Resource diversification: alternative representations (graphs, numeric, symbolic) to deepen understanding.
  • Assessment implications: potential inflation of scores if not paired with higher-order tasks.

Strategic usage guidelines for Marist schools

  1. Define目的 and boundaries: articulate when Mathway is used for exploration versus assessment, and require students to show conceptual reasoning before accepting solutions.
  2. Embed qualitative tasks: pair calculations with word problems that require justification, interpretation, and reflection on methods.
  3. Promote metacognition: require students to explain their thinking in journal entries or brief videos after solving with Mathway.
  4. Align with spiritual formation: connect math problems to real-world service scenarios or social justice contexts to foster discernment and responsibility.
  5. Guarantee equitable access: ensure devices and connectivity are reliable so that all students benefit without distraction or stigma.

Implications for teaching practice

Educators should calibrate their instruction to balance automated computation with deep reasoning. High-quality questions, such as "What is the underlying principle here?" or "How would you prove this result without the calculator?" push students toward enduring mathematical understanding. In Mesoamerican and Andean contexts, where resource variability exists, teachers can use Mathway as a bridge to concepts rather than a shortcut to answers.

Policy and governance considerations

School leadership must formalize policy on device usage, privacy, and assessment integrity. A recommended framework includes:

  • Usage policy: when students may access Mathway, and what documentation is required for completed work.
  • Assessment alignment: design tests that require explanation beyond the final answer, rendering mere answer retrieval insufficient.
  • Professional development: ongoing training for teachers to integrate the tool with Marist pedagogy and spirituality.
  • Data privacy: ensure compliance with local regulations and safeguarding student information across our network of Latin American schools.

FAQ

[How does Mathway fit Marist pedagogy?

Mathway fits Marist pedagogy when used to promote discernment, critical thinking, and service-oriented problem solving, rather than mere answer retrieval. It should be part of a balanced toolkit aligned with spiritual formation and social mission.

[Is Mathway appropriate for assessment?

Yes when used with tasks that require justification, explanation, and concept illustration. Assessments should reward reasoning and scaffolded understanding in addition to computational accuracy.

[What safeguards minimize dependence?

Establish explicit usage limits, require written explanations, and rotate roles so students lead discussions about methods. Pair technology with human feedback and reflective practice to maintain learning depth.

[How can schools implement effectively?

Start with a pilot in one grade level, develop a cross-disciplinary plan, train teachers, and continuously monitor outcomes through a Marist-centered rubric that emphasizes formation, excellence, and solidarity.

[What about equity and access?

Provide devices, reliable connectivity, and after-school support to ensure all students can engage meaningfully, minimizing gaps due to socioeconomic differences.
